Driving to and from work. Driving to and from work can be risky, particularly after a long shift, a night shift or before an early start. Coupled with eating healthy, staying hydrated will help keep you energized and alert. Avoid sugary sodas and fruit juices, which will make your blood sugar spike and then crash. WebApr 11, 2024 · The best night shift schedule for your business will depend on your productivity needs, industry and the size of your team. The most common night shift schedules are: 2-2-3 shift schedule (Panama schedule) 4-on 4-off shift schedule. DuPont shift schedule. 2-3-2 shift schedule (Pitman schedule) 5-5-4 shift schedule. WebIt takes about 10 days for the body to adjust to night shift work. However, it is common for night shift workers to revert to daytime routines for a day or two during days off, which tends to make the circadian rhythm unstable. WebMar 31, 2024 · On days off, try to stay up until the middle of the night (3-4 a.m.), and sleep until noon or 1 p.m. That way, your body always has some hours of sleep that are the same every 24-hour period (for example, 8 a.m. to noon is always a sleep time, on both work and rest days).
